Software Development Engineer | HumanBit main
full-time
Posted on July 20, 2025
Job Description
SDE
Company Overview
Not specified.
Job Summary
The Software Development Engineer (SDE) will design, develop, and implement software applications that are crucial to the organization's technology stack. This role focuses on leveraging programming skills to develop high-quality software solutions that meet business objectives and enhance user experiences.
Responsibilities
- Design, code, and debug applications in various software languages.
- Collaborate with cross-functional teams to analyze, design, and implement new features.
- Conduct code reviews and provide constructive feedback to fellow developers.
- Identify and resolve performance issues in applications to improve user experience.
- Maintain documentation of software designs and application processes.
Qualifications
- Strong proficiency in programming languages such as Java, C#, Python, or JavaScript.
- Familiarity with software development methodologies, including Agile and Scrum.
- Experience with version control systems (e.g., Git).
- Knowledge of database management systems (e.g., MySQL, PostgreSQL).
- Bachelor’s degree in Computer Science, Information Technology, or related field.
- Problem-solving skills and attention to detail.
- Excellent communication skills and ability to work in a team environment.
Preferred Skills
- Experience with cloud computing platforms (e.g., AWS, Azure).
- Knowledge of front-end technologies such as HTML, CSS, and JavaScript frameworks (e.g., React, Angular).
- Experience with CI/CD pipelines and DevOps practices.
- Familiarity with containerization technologies (e.g., Docker, Kubernetes).
Experience
- Typically requires 2-5 years of relevant experience in software development.
Environment
The typical work setting is a tech-focused office environment. Flexibility for remote work may be available depending on company policies.
Salary
Not specified.
Growth Opportunities
Potential for career advancement to senior developer roles or managerial positions within the software development team.
Benefits
Not specified.